Charlize Theron Opens Up About Family Trauma and Its Impact on Her Life

11 articles · Updated · Entertainment Weekly News · Apr 18
  • Charlize Theron has spoken candidly about her traumatic childhood in South Africa, including her mother killing her father in self-defense.
  • Theron described her father's alcoholism and verbal abuse, and how her mother acted to protect them during a violent incident when Theron was 15.
  • Reflecting on these experiences, Theron credits her resilience and parenting style to her upbringing and aims to instill strength and appreciation for life in her daughters.
